| Description: | Our Gene-specific Break Apart Probes usually target the flanks of the target gene (WISP3). Due to this design method, our probe products can detect chromosomal rearrangements, such as translocations, by FISH.The product usually consists of a reagent combination composed of a probe with a selected dye color and a hybridization reagent. |
| Application: | WISP3 Gene-specific Break Apart Probe is designed to detect potential WISP3 rearrangements. This probe has been confirmed on the metaphase and interphase chromosomes by FISH. | Gene Name | WNT1 Inducible Signaling Pathway Protein 3 |
| Gene Summary [Provided by RefSeq] | This gene encodes a member of the WNT1 inducible signaling pathway (WISP) protein subfamily, which belongs to the connective tissue growth factor (CTGF) family. WNT1 is a member of a family of cysteine-rich, glycosylated signaling proteins that mediate diverse developmental processes. The CTGF family members are characterized by four conserved cysteine-rich domains: insulin-like growth factor-binding domain, von Willebrand factor type C module, thrombospondin domain and C-terminal cystine knot-like domain. This gene is overexpressed in colon tumors. It may be downstream in the WNT1 signaling pathway that is relevant to malignant transformation. Mutations of this gene are associated with progressive pseudorheumatoid dysplasia, an autosomal recessive skeletal disorder, indicating that the gene is essential for normal postnatal skeletal growth and cartilage homeostasis.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008] |
